Turning my dog, Webby, into a fashion plate has become a new favorite hobby. For one thing, knitting for my little 18 lb dog provides the gratification of completing a project in just hours (or at most, a day or two), as opposed to many days (or weeks/months/years even!) for larger projects such as blankets and human clothes.

Here, she is sporting the first sweater I ever made for her. I started with Bernat Baby Coordinates in Soft Mauve for the main body piece, and Patons Brilliant in Sparkling Rose for the collar, the under piece and the flower accents.

Many of the dog sweater patterns I looked at online really didn’t suit her proportions. As you can see in the pictures, she has a very long body, but her rib cage and belly are very thin in comparison.  I knit the back piece without too much of a problem…
